Glass Recycling
Glass has the least volatile pricing of all the post consumer recycling commodities. Composed of sand and potash; bottle glass is made from readily available and inexpensive raw materials. To be competitive, recycled glass must maintain a price that competes with these abundant raw materials. Traded as flint (clear), amber (brown), emerald (green) or mixed color broken glass.
The price depends on the cleanliness and color of the recycled product. Clean flint cullet (another w ord for broken glass) is usually the most desirable form of recycled glass scrap. Mixed color broken glass with ceramics or stones mixed in it is the least desirable grade of cullet bringing the lowest price. Most Recyclers color sort and break or crush and screen bottles before selling their product.
Modern, high production bottle manufacturing requires very clean and uniform feedstock. Over the past decade there has been a growth in the glass benefacti on sector. These are intermediate processors that receive glass from recycling programs and run it through a series of steps to remove any contaminants (rocks, ceramics, metal caps, etc.) and provide a uniform feedstock to the bottle manufacturers. These preprocessor provide an excellent market for recycling programs that do not have the volume or ability to produce glass for direct mill delivery. Glass beneficiation plants use sophisticated optical sorting machines to separate the glass into the three color types. They may also x-ray the glass to detect any rocks or ceramics which are then removed. Magnets and eddy current separators are used to removed magnetic and non-magnetic metal contamination from caps and lids. The end product is a uniformly sized load of ground glass that is free of contaminants readily acceptable by bottle manufacturers.
Lower grades of recycled glass that are too mixed or contaminated, may be used in concrete or in road paving material called "Glass halt". In some areas where there is an overabundance of low grade glass it is used to cover over the rubbish in the land fill in place of sand. This is not truly recycling and it is hoped that better sorting technology will soon make this material usable for new bottles.
Glass recycling saves energy because recycled glass can be processed at a lower temperature than blending new glass from raw materials. Also, recycled glass is usually closer to the bottle plants than the sources of potash, the most expensive com ponent in glass bottles and jars. Bout 32% of energy can be saved because of its low melting point.
It is easier to manufacture new glassware from recycled glass than from raw material, which can also reduce air pollution by 20%, and water pollution by 50%.

with复合结构的构成
上面两句话中都出现了With复合结构,这个句型具体有以下几种用法:
①with+宾语+名词
He died with his daughter yet a school girl.他死的时候,他的女儿还是个学生.
②with+宾语+形容词
He used to sleep with all the windows open.他过去常常开着窗子睡觉.
③with+宾语+副词
The girl fell asleep with the light on.那位女孩睡着了,灯还亮着.
④with+宾语+不定式
I can't go out with these clothes to w ash.因为这些衣服要洗,我不能出去.
⑤with+宾语+介词短语
He sat near the fire with his back to the door.他坐在炉子旁,背朝着房门.
⑥with+宾语+现在分词
She lives in the room with the light burning.她住在亮着灯的那个房间里.
⑦with+宾语+过去分词
With everything done, she went home.做完一切事情以后,她回家了.

Floor sweeping, dusting, window cleaning, picking up the kids, doing the laundry, folding clothes, tidying the house: such activities are common in our life. Yet, if engineers are right, by 2020, we may not need to do them by ourselves, thanks to
the development of domestic (家庭的) robots.
“We a lready have grass-cutting robots. The public have happily accepted them working around their gardens,” says expert Gordon Wyeth of Brisbane’s University of Queensland. “N ow robots able to walk and balance on two legs are becoming common in laboratories, a nd their working ability is always rising while costs fall.”
As a result, home robots will be the next “must have” for buyers by 2020 when they will have become as necessary as personal computers today. They will be smart, ready to finish their tasks and will work together with humans and other smart robots.
“I am sure most home robots will end up being named and treated like pets,” added Wyeth. “They will create a whole new industry.”
Robots can expect to face a lot of technological competition in the home, thanks to developments in materials. At the University of New South Wales in Sydney, for example, researchers, led by Rose Amal an d Michael Brungs, are developing self-cleaning surfaces for use in hospitals as well as home kitchens and bathrooms. The surfaces will also be designed so that droplets (小液滴) cannot form on them.
What’s more, scientists are working on materials that will not only change our homes but will change the way we dress through the creation of “intelligent (智能的) clothes”. Special fabr ics (纺织品), fitted with monitors, will study our health throughout the day while we sleep, work and exercise.
